The GKU D600 Pro Max sits at the top of this ranking and the listing explains why. It describes a Sony STARVIS 2 sensor recording at 2160p up front with a 170 degree field of view, fed over a 5.8GHz WiFi 6 connection the listing rates at up to 20MB/s for downloads. GPS, voice control, a built-in microphone and speaker and a 3-inch IPS display are all named.

The detail that matters most for a dash cam in a hot car is not in the headline at all: the listing specifies a supercapacitor rather than a lithium battery, which is the version that survives summer dashboard temperatures. A 12+12 month warranty is named as well. At the time of collection it carried 1,801 ratings at 4.5 stars. Everything here comes from the Amazon listing rather than our own testing.

“I fitted this in my car and it was very simple to do. It comes with all the necessary wiring connections and when powered up the app is very good. It down loads clips very fast that makes it easy to use. The size of the camera is such that it hides behind the rear view mirror and is out of sight pretty much from the drivers view. I haven’t yet fitted the rear camera although I have connected it and when connected there is an I screen view of both front and rear cameras. The gps which is built in gives an accurate location and speed which is recorded to the file that is down loaded. Over all it is very good for the price and I wish I had bought two intact. Using one at the front and one at the back to avoid running a cable from front to rear which on my car requires lowering the head lining which I don’t want to do.”
